What Our Psychologists Do
Our psychologists provide evidence-based treatment for workplace psychological injuries including anxiety, depression, PTSD, bullying-related trauma, and adjustment disorders. We offer both in-person and telehealth sessions, and all approved treatment is covered by WorkCover at no cost to you.
Learn more about our WorkCover Psychologist →- ✓Psychological assessment for workplace injuries
- ✓Evidence-based therapy (CBT, EMDR, and more)
- ✓Confidential in-person and telehealth sessions
- ✓Clinical reports for your insurer
- ✓Support for return-to-work readiness

Common Work Injuries in Auburn
Auburn's workforce leans on Manufacturing, Logistics and Construction. The work injuries our team treats and documents most often here:
- Industrial deafness Years of plant noise, compressed-air tools and line machinery.
- Back injury from lifting and posture Repetitive lifting, awkward posture and prolonged standing.
- Shoulder injury Overhead line work, assembly reach and heavy handling.
- Wrist and hand RSI Assembly line, packing and inspection tasks.
- Eye injuries from debris and chemicals Grinding, splashing and airborne particulate exposure.
- Burns from chemicals and heat Caustic chemicals, hot surfaces and molten material splash.
